Competition schedule and items of events (plan) Sep. 12 (Wed.)
Safety and Technical Inspection, Tilt/Noise/Brake -Test
Static Event - Presentation, Cost & Manufacturing Analysis , Design, Presentation
Sep. 13 (Thu.)
Safety and Technical Inspection, Tilt/Noise/Brake -Test
Dynamic Event - Acceleration (acceleration performance from 0 to 75 m), Skid-Pad (figure eight handling test), Autocross (against the clock)
Sep. 14 (Fri.)
Safety and Technical Inspection, Tilt/Noise/Brake -Test
Dynamic Event - Endurance (endurance running) and Fuel Economy (fuel consumption)
Sep. 15 (Sat.)
Dynamic Event - Endurance (endurance running) and Fuel Economy (fuel consumption)
Awards ceremony

Team members Students and a faculty advisor
Participant requirements
  • One team and one vehicle from one university is obligatory except when the university has several campuses and a team is formed at each campus.
  • Team members should be 18 years old or above, as a rule, and are restricted to the students of national colleges of technology, junior colleges, universities, graduate schools, or similar education/training organizations. Individuals who graduated within seven months prior to the competition date are also qualified. Registration of a team requires registration of all team members and one faculty advisor.
  • The faculty advisor must accompany the team throughout the competition period.
  • All teams are required to take out accident insurance for all team members (including cover for the driver while driving in the competition).
  • Drivers are required to be 18 years old or above, with a valid government-issued driver's license.
  • Team members must be a student of registrated University.
  • Vehicles that have already been presented in the past FSAE competition in Japan cannot be registered. At least a frame of the vehicle must be newly designed.
